# Break-Glass Access: Nightpane Admin Dashboard

The dark-mode theming service for the Nightpane admin dashboard is gated behind the Umbrel vault, since theme overrides can inject CSS into privileged views. Routine changes go through the Corvid release pipeline with two-person review. If the pipeline is unavailable and a critical contrast regression blocks operators, break-glass access is permitted. Retrieve the sealed envelope from the on-call binder, log the event in the Umbrel audit channel, and unlock using the recovery passphrase below.

recovery phrase for kajop-yagef: istael-ulaius

## BranchSweep Runbook (fragment)

BranchSweep is our stale-branch cleanup bot—it nukes branches with no commits in 90 days, after pinging the owner twice. From a security angle: it runs with a scoped deploy token, never touches protected branches, and logs every deletion with a restore snapshot kept for 30 days. If you need to audit what it deleted and why, the full action history sits in its audit database, which you can query using the connection string below.

replica DSN, kajep-yahag: mssql://praok_svc:iF@db-8d68.plorvaio.local:5432/eliion

Hi sales leads — quick planning note on the new Lumivault subscription tier before next quarter kicks off. We're slotting "Lumivault Summit" between the current Pro and Enterprise plans, aimed at mid-size shops that keep asking for usage caps without the full contract dance. Pricing lands in the pilot range we tested in the Drexley accounts, and enablement decks go out in week two. Please hold off quoting it externally until launch day. There's one confidential note on the rollout plan directly below.

board note of fahif-yahog: Gross margin on Wenath came in at 10 percent against a plan of 5 percent. Only 3 of the 100 pilot accounts renewed Wenath, so a churn review is set for July 15.

Contrast audit runs nightly against Lanternview's component library. Failures page on-call only if the AA threshold regresses on a shipped screen. Don't silence the check; file a ticket and tag the design-systems channel. Known false positives: overlay gradients and the charting palette. Fixes go through the token repo, never inline styles. Audit results, thresholds, and the suppression list are on this page.

runbook for badug-kadup: https://confluence.zemvarlabs.internal/projects/browse/display/projects/bd1b